How To Write A Speech by Edward J. Hegarty is a comprehensive guidebook that provides practical tips and techniques for creating effective speeches. The book covers all aspects of speechwriting, from analyzing the audience and choosing a topic to organizing the content and delivering the speech with confidence. The author begins by discussing the importance of understanding the purpose and context of the speech, as well as the audience's interests and expectations. He then provides step-by-step instructions for developing a clear and compelling message, using rhetorical devices and persuasive language to engage the audience. The book also includes chapters on structuring the speech, incorporating anecdotes and humor, and using visual aids to enhance the presentation. Hegarty offers advice on overcoming stage fright, projecting confidence, and handling unexpected challenges during the speech. Throughout the book, Hegarty provides numerous examples and exercises to help readers practice and improve their speechwriting skills.
